Modern Architecture In Venice Italy. The Venice Architecture Biennale exhibition is the premier showcase for revolutionary ideas in contemporary architecture and design through national venues. Ca Pesaro International Gallery of Modern Art Secondly Ca Pesaro is a masterpiece of Venetian Baroque civil architecture designed by the greatest architect of the Venetian Baroque Baldassarre Longhena. The interior frescoes are complemented by modern masterpieces by artists such as Klimt De Chirico Kandinsky and Miró. 1937 Franco Stella b.
